We are seeking a Human Resources Student for our North American Headquarters (NAHQ) in Edmonton, Alberta, that is available for 4 months starting in September 2025. This position will be under the direct supervisor of the District HRPD Advisor.


As a Human Resources Student and depending on your assigned project, you will have the opportunity to contribute to our team by:

Assists with all aspects of the district student program including full cycle recruitment, onboarding/off boarding, compensation research, student events and career fair participation.
Supports the district learning and development processes:
Assists with tracking and reporting for internal training.
Assists with virtual and in class training set up.
Supports district HRPD initiatives related to employee engagement, diversity and inclusion and health & wellness.
Supports monthly metrics and reporting processes related to career management and vacation planning.
Supports activities requiring a high degree of confidentiality, attention to detail, and accuracy.
Other duties as required.
What you will bring to the role:
Pursuing a degree or diploma with a Human Resources Major.
Must be proactive in terms of anticipating needs and follow-up items for the project team.
Proficient in Microsoft office products such as Excel, PowerPoint, Word, and Access.
Must have excellent interpersonal and organizational skills.
Exhibits strict confidentiality with all information.
Must be independent and resourceful to accomplish day- to-day tasks and assignments.
Must have excellent verbal, written, and grammatical skills.
Must demonstrate initiative and the ability to handle multiple tasks and changing priorities under tight deadlines, while maintaining a high degree of accuracy and professionalism.
Strong time-management skills with the ability to effectively manage multiple aggressive deadlines.
